Components of Thermo King Units

Thermo King refrigeration units consist of several key components, including:

- Compressor: Responsible for compressing refrigerant and circulating it through the system.
- Condenser: Converts refrigerant from gas to liquid by releasing heat.
- Evaporator: Absorbs heat from the cargo area, cooling the air inside.
- Expansion Valve: Regulates the flow of refrigerant into the evaporator.
- Control System: Monitors and regulates the operation of the entire refrigeration system.

What is Code 10?

Code 10 is a specific diagnostic error code generated by the Thermo King control system indicating a fault in the operation of the refrigeration unit. When this code appears, it typically means that there is a problem with the compressor or the system's ability to maintain the desired temperature.

Implications of Code 10

When Code 10 is activated, it signals to the operator that the refrigeration unit is not functioning optimally. This can have several implications:

- Temperature Fluctuation: The cargo may be exposed to temperatures that can compromise its integrity.
- Increased Fuel Consumption: The unit may work harder to maintain temperature, leading to higher fuel costs.
- Potential Product Loss: Perishable goods at improper temperatures can spoil, leading to financial losses.
- Service Downtime: The need for repairs can result in delays and interruptions in transport operations.

Common Causes of Code 10

Identifying the root cause of Code 10 is essential for timely resolution. Here are some common reasons why this error may appear:

1. Compressor Issues

- Overheating: If the compressor overheats, it may fail to operate correctly, triggering Code 10.
- Refrigerant Shortage: Low refrigerant levels can cause the compressor to work harder, leading to issues.
- Electrical Failures: Faulty wiring or connections can disrupt power supply to the compressor.

2. System Blockages

- Clogged Filters: Dirty or clogged filters can restrict airflow and reduce efficiency.
- Frozen Evaporator: Ice buildup on the evaporator coils can hinder heat exchange, affecting performance.

3. Control System Malfunctions

- Faulty Sensors: Temperature or pressure sensors that are not functioning correctly can lead to inaccurate readings.
- Software Glitches: Outdated or corrupted software can lead to erroneous error codes.

4. Environmental Factors

- Extreme Ambient Temperatures: Very hot or cold external conditions can affect the unit’s performance.
- Improper Ventilation: Inadequate airflow around the unit can lead to overheating or inefficiencies.

Troubleshooting Code 10

When Code 10 appears, operators should take a systematic approach to troubleshoot the issue. Here are steps to follow:

Step 1: Check the Display

- Look for additional error codes or messages on the control panel that may provide more insights.

Step 2: Inspect the Compressor

- Listen for Unusual Noises: Grinding or squealing sounds can indicate mechanical issues.
- Check Temperature: Ensure that the compressor is not overheating.

Step 3: Examine Refrigerant Levels

- Inspect for Leaks: Look for any signs of refrigerant leaks around the system.
- Check Gauge Readings: Use pressure gauges to assess refrigerant levels.

Step 4: Clean Filters and Coils

- Replace Dirty Filters: Clean or replace air filters to improve airflow.
- Defrost Evaporator Coils: If ice is present, allow the unit to defrost completely.

Step 5: Review Electrical Connections

- Inspect Wiring: Check for damaged or loose wires that could affect power supply.
- Test Sensors: Use a multimeter to verify sensor functionality.

Step 6: Consult the Manual

- Refer to the Thermo King operation manual specific to your model for guidance on troubleshooting Code 10.
